Hi everyone...
I was looking at the packaging for Berg Rapid Sepia toner, and it indicates that the bleach contains no ferricyanide.

Anyone know what the active ingredient in this bleach is? Berg doesn't seem to have a website up, and there doesn't seem to be an MSDS readily available either...

Anyone know for sure?

Copper Sulfate I think

I mixed an old partial bottle of this on Monday - the bleach still is active, but the dried out then re-dissolved sepia toner was kaput.

The bleach is blue, which to me is copper. I have a formula for an alternative c41/e6 bleach based around copper sulfate, which is also found in nurseries as a growth erradicant for around patios, as I recall.

I have not tried to mix my own copper bleach, untill my ferricyanide supply runs out; it works fine for me. I just turn it in at the HHW depot when I go there to hand over spent fixers. I do have copper, but just to do copper toning.

Most likely copper sulfate, NaCl and some sort of H+. I think the stuff I mix uses a few mils of sulfuric acid per liter stock.

Mike, your own is cheap to mix and it can provide a wide latitude of effects in redevelopment. I don't even use ferricyanide/KBr anymore except for light general bleaching, I love the other stuff so much.
